What is Mmdv.dll?

A DLL file, or Dynamic Link Library, is a type of file containing code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. mmdv.dll is a specific DLL file that serves an important role in computer systems, especially with the software called 'Mobile Master.' This file contains code and data that Mobile Master needs to function properly, making it a crucial component of the software. mmdv.dll provides specific functions and resources that Mobile Master relies on to perform tasks such as syncing data between a computer and a mobile device.

Without 'mmdv.dll,' Mobile Master might not work correctly or might not work at all. Therefore, ensuring that mmdv.dll is properly installed and functioning is essential for the smooth operation of Mobile Master and the ability to manage and sync data effectively.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• Mmdv.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• Mmdv.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• Mmdv.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the mmdv.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
  • This application failed to start because mmdv.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
  • The file mmdv.dll is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.
